    //this will execute the click method if any alphabet  is selected from the grid to create the answer string
    public void OnClick(int row, int col)
    {
        Button       temp = myQuestionArry [row, col];                      // get button of corresponding row and col
        AlphaBetInfo info = temp.gameObject.GetComponent <AlphaBetInfo> (); // get its info from AlphabetInfo class

        if (info.IsAnswerChar())
        {
            // if it is already a part of answer then user must have clicked this to remove from answer array
            // so remove it and put it back to its original position
            temp.GetComponent <RectTransform> ().position = info.GetOriginalPosition();
            currentAnsweGridNo = info.GetAnswerIndex();
            info.SetAnswerChar(false);
            noOfLetterClicked--;
            destructionArry.Remove(temp);
        }
        else
        {
            // if its a fresh selection then mark it as a part of answer string and put it in current answer array
            info.SetAnswerChar(true);
            temp.GetComponent <RectTransform> ().position = answerGridArry[currentAnsweGridNo];
            info.SetAnswerIndex(currentAnsweGridNo);
            answerArray[currentAnsweGridNo] = info.GetButtonId();
            noOfLetterClicked++;
            currentAnsweGridNo = noOfLetterClicked;
            destructionArry.Add(temp);
        }
    }
